Rewarding work

All Falklands education follows the UK curriculum. Matthew started learning about 3D shapes the previous day, and already he is reeling off "cuboid" and "square-based pyramid" as Wendy passes him the wooden shapes.

"It’s so intense when I am here, in five afternoons of science I can cover what I would do in half a term at conventional school," says Wendy, 58.

"It's the most rewarding job I have ever done; you’re working one-to-one and you can really see the progress."
